The Federal Government on Monday November 4, delivered palliatives to sea incursion victims of Ayetoro Community in Ilaje Local Government Area of Ondo State.
While delivering the items at the Igbokoda Naval Base, the representative of the Minister of Regional Development, Hon Engineer Abubakar Momoh, the Onibudo of Ugboland, Chief ‘Wole Iroaye, said: “These palliatives are from the Presidency through the Honourable Minister of Regional Development, Hon. Engineer Abubakar Momoh, FNSE.
“They are not for women alone; they are not for men alone; they are not for the youths alone. There must be no discrimination in the distribution. The items are meant for the entire Ayetoro Community.
“We have been asked by the Presidency through the office of the Honourable Minister of Regional Development to deliver a truck of rice to the Ayetoro Community.
“This is the mandate we have from the Honourable Minister, Hon. Engineer Abubakar Momoh, FNSE, and it is to the knowledge of the Governor of Ondo State, His Excellency, Hon. Lucky Orimisan Aiyedatiwa. And we are doing this in company of the Ondo State Government’s representatives.”
